Understanding Website Accessibility

Website accessibility means that websites, tools, and technologies are designed and developed so that people with disabilities can use them. More importantly, it's about providing all users access to the same information, regardless of the impairments they may have.

Financial Services Web Design

In the financial sector, trust and clarity are paramount. Your website design should reflect these qualities, providing a secure and straightforward user experience.

Essentials of Financial Services Web Design

  1. Robust security features
  2. Clear information architecture
  3. Real-time financial updates
  4. Easy navigation to key services
